How Climate and Seasons Forming Home Decisions



Summers in Gastonia run hot and heavy with moisture, and June mid-days frequently bring abrupt electrical storms rolling off the Piedmont hillsides. Residences developed years ago have a tendency to count on crawl spaces as opposed to cellars, considering that the area's clay-heavy soil holds water and makes conventional basements much less useful. Customers visiting homes in July promptly find out to ask about cooling and heating age, attic insulation, and rain gutter water drainage, due to the fact that a system resisting ninety-degree heat shows its weak points quick. Winters stay moderate compared to much of the country, yet a periodic ice storm still checks roof coverings and power lines. Way of living variables change with the weather condition too, since family members drawn to outside spots like Crowders Hill or the Daniel Stowe Arboretum often want a backyard or trail accessibility nearby, which narrows the search in means a common filter on a map never ever quite catches. Anyone not familiar with these seasonal patterns gain from someone who has seen how neighborhood homes hold up through both extremes, instead of guessing from a common examination list.
